Bill Summary

AN ACT to amend the real property tax law, in relation to authorizing certain exemptions from school district real property taxes for volunteer firefighters

AI Summary

This bill creates a new tax exemption for volunteer firefighters, allowing them to receive a partial property tax exemption for school district purposes under specific conditions. The exemption applies to real property owned by an enrolled member of an incorporated volunteer fire company or fire department, or jointly owned with their spouse, but only if the school district first adopts a local law approving such an exemption. To qualify, the firefighter must: reside in the school district served by their fire company, use the property as their primary residence exclusively for residential purposes, and have been certified as an active member of the volunteer fire company for at least five years. The exemption is limited to $12,000 multiplied by the local equalization rate. Additionally, volunteer firefighters who have accrued more than 20 years of active service can receive the exemption for the remainder of their life, provided they continue to reside in the same school district. The bill ensures that existing firefighter benefits are not reduced by this new tax exemption, and requires firefighters to apply for the exemption annually with their local assessor using a state-prescribed form.
